DEER OF THE WORLD

by Valerius Geist

Published by Swan Hill Press. 1st. 1999

Very good condition in a very good dustwrapper. Their Evolution, Behaviour and Ecology. Large, heavy format. Blue cloth, silver title to spine. Colour photos, b/w illustrations. 421 pages.

Spine and corners slightly bumped and rubbed. A couple of small, light marks to textblock. Dustwrapper is price-cut and slightly edge creased.
